Many drivers find themselves needing insurance despite not owning a vehicle, especially when renting or borrowing cars. If you're in this situation, non-owner SR-22 insurance could be your solution. This type of policy is specifically designed for drivers who don't own a vehicle but need to meet state insurance requirements, often due to past driving infractions. The SR-22 form acts as proof that you've got the minimum liability coverage mandated by your state, which is vital for maintaining your driving privileges. The SR-22 form is required by many states for individuals who have committed serious driving offenses.

To qualify for non-owner SR-22 insurance, you mustn't own a vehicle or live with someone who does. This coverage provides liability protection for accidents that occur while driving borrowed or rented vehicles, making it a practical option for those who frequently find themselves in such circumstances. Unlike traditional auto insurance policies, non-owner SR-22 insurance is generally cheaper because it excludes collision and extensive coverage, allowing you to save on premiums while fulfilling legal requirements. Moreover, not all states mandate SR-22 after a driving offense, so it's crucial to check your local regulations.

Non-owner SR-22 insurance offers affordable liability coverage for drivers without a vehicle, ideal for borrowing or renting.

When you opt for non-owner SR-22 insurance, remember that it offers secondary coverage. This means that if you're involved in an accident, the vehicle owner's insurance will pay first, while your non-owner policy kicks in afterward. It's important to purchase a plan that meets your state's minimum liability coverage levels. Additionally, most states charge a filing fee for the SR-22 form, usually around $25, which adds to your initial costs. Keep in mind that you'll typically need this coverage for at least three years, and your premiums may increase depending on the underlying reason for needing the SR-22.

When searching for affordable non-owner SR-22 insurance, it's important to shop around. Different insurance companies may offer varying rates, and high-risk insurers like The General, SafeAuto, and Direct Auto Insurance specialize in providing coverage for drivers who need SR-22 filings. Prices can vary greatly based on your location, as well as the specific requirements of your state. For instance, you might find that policies in Chicago range from $600 to over $2,600 annually, while quotes from companies like The General in Los Angeles can provide additional insights.
